Kazuko Sugiyama, born Kazuko Shibukawa on April 9, 1947, in Nagoya City, Aichi Prefecture, is a versatile Japanese actress and voice artist. Affiliated with Aoni Production, she is renowned for her work in anime, notably voicing Heidi in "Heidi, Girl of the Alps," Akane Kimidori in "Dr. Slump," and Ten in "Urusei Yatsura." Beyond her prolific voice acting career, Sugiyama teaches at the Osaka University of the Arts, imparting her expertise in broadcasting and voice acting to the next generation.
